Binary Patching Using OPatch. OPatch is a utility that allows you to apply and/or roll back interim patches to Oracle's software. The manual process of applying a patch is called binary patching. For binary patching, you can use the OPatch utility to: Note. Always refer to the patch README for any special instructions before you apply a patch. You can back up the ORACLE. You can use any method, such as zip, cp - r, tar, and cpio to compress the ORACLE. For example, if you are patching a 1. Oracle Home, then use OPatch version 1. If the Oracle Home is version 1. OPatch version 1. Oracle recommends that you use the latest released OPatch for 1. My Oracle Support (patch 6. Select the ARU link for the 1. You can also view the support document . This document contains a link to the instructional video . You must ensure that the ORACLE. Check your respective vendor documentation for the details on how to set the environment variable. Note. Oracle Universal Installer binaries and inventories must be present in the home to be patched. Other environment variables used include: OPATCH. For this, you use the opatchlsinventory command with either the patch or patch. For this, you use the OPatch - report option to print all patch application actions OPatch will perform without actually executing the actions. Example 2- 2 report Option. ![]() ![]() For more information about the - report option, see . For this, you use the OPatch apply command. Example 2- 3 apply Command. For more information about this command, see. For this, you again use the OPatch lsinventory command with either the patch or patch. For more information about this OPatch command, see . You can run it with various commands and options. Use OPatch to reference the file and apply the patches: Create the text file of the patch location. The entry should have each patch location on a separate line. Save your changes. Apply the patches with OPatch. Base. File < location of text file>. Base. File /tmp/patches/patches. Patch Conflict Detection and Resolution. ![]() OPatch detects and reports any conflicts encountered when applying a patch with a previously applied patch. The patch application fails in case of conflicts. You can use the - force option of OPatch to override this failure. If you specify - force, the installer firsts rolls back any conflicting patches and then proceeds with the installation of the desired patch. Using - force means that you will likely lose some bug fixes, that are causing the conflict, in exchange for getting the incoming patch to be applied. You may experience a bug conflict and might want to remove the conflicting patch. This process is known as patch rollback. 2 Binary Patching Using OPatch. OPatch is a utility that allows you to apply and/or roll back interim patches to Oracle's. Differences between PSU. Patch Set Updates (PSU). To download them we have to go to MOS (My Oracle Support). During patch installation, OPatch saves copies of all the files that were replaced by the new patch before the new versions of these files are loaded, and stores them in $ORACLE. These saved files are called rollback files and are key to making patch rollback possible. When you roll back a patch, these rollback files are restored to the system. If you have a complete understanding of the patch rollback process, you should only override the default behavior by using the - force flag. To roll back a patch, execute the following command. What is the difference between CPU patch and PSU patch.Can we. Hi, What is the difference between CPU patch and PSU patch.Read this, https://blogs.oracle.com. Apply Psu Patch Oracle Database Oracle . Posts about oracle psu vc cpu vs patchset written by Shan Nawaz. PSU’s(Patch set updates). OPatch/opatch rollback - id < Patch. OPatch and OPatch. Auto help you avoid these conflicts by identifying these conditions. When patch conflicts occur and you are unable to resolve them using documented support procedures, MOS then becomes the go- to source for technical assistance. Conflict resolution may entail filing a Service Request and obtaining a Merge Label Request (MLR) patch to overcome a patching issue. Once a solution has been found, you use OPatch to apply the fixed patch.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. Archives
September 2016
Categories |